Zip code 15358, located in Centerville, Pennsylvania, has experienced significant demographic and housing market changes over the past decade. This small community, spanning just 0.34 square miles, has seen fluctuations in homeownership rates and housing prices that reflect broader economic trends. The homeownership rate in zip code 15358 has shown a general decline from 2013 to 2022, with some fluctuations. In 2013, the homeownership rate stood at 73%, but by 2022, it had decreased to 68%. This trend coincides with changes in average home prices. In 2013, the average home price was $63,675, and it steadily increased to $92,838 by 2022, representing a 45.8% increase over nine years. The most significant jump occurred between 2020 and 2021, when average home prices rose from $72,363 to $87,879, a 21.4% increase in just one year.
The relationship between federal interest rates and homeownership rates in this zip code shows some correlation. As interest rates remained low from 2013 to 2020 (ranging from 0.09% to 0.38%), homeownership rates remained relatively stable, fluctuating between 69% and 74%. However, as interest rates began to rise in 2022 to 1.68%, the homeownership rate dipped to 68%, suggesting that higher interest rates may have influenced some residents' ability or willingness to purchase homes.
Renter percentages in zip code 15358 have generally increased from 2013 to 2022, inversely mirroring the homeownership trend. The renter percentage rose from 27% in 2013 to 31% in 2022, with a peak of 36% in 2018. Average rent prices, however, have not shown a consistent upward trend. In 2013, the average rent was $950, which fluctuated over the years, dropping to a low of $624 in 2018 before rising back to $848 in 2022. The population decline from 279 in 2013 to 226 in 2022 may have influenced these rent price variations, as lower demand could have kept rent prices from rising consistently.
In 2023 and 2024, the housing market in zip code 15358 continued to show growth. The average home price increased to $96,878 in 2023 and further to $106,431 in 2024, representing a 14.6% increase over two years. This growth occurred despite a significant rise in federal interest rates, which reached 5.02% in 2023 and 5.33% in 2024. These higher interest rates would typically be expected to slow housing price growth, but other factors such as local demand or limited housing supply may have contributed to the continued price increases.
